The MEMEX project will be adopted for the Bauhaus of the Seas

The MEMEX project, which involved the participation of Valentina Nisi and Nuno Nunes, both Professors at DEI, aimed to promote social cohesion through collaborative tools that provided inclusive access to tangible and intangible cultural heritage while facilitating encounters, discussions, and interactions among socially excluded communities.

The Bauhaus of the Seas project, which includes the participation of Professor Nuno Nunes, a Full Professor at DEI, brings together scientists, artists, architects, and local communities in the search for solutions to environmental problems in the ocean.

The MEMEX project was concluded in November 2022, and as the project approached its end, the MEMEX team began considering how to extend its legacy. The possibility of new collaborations emerged, and from this perspective, the MEMEX platform will be used in the New European Bauhaus project, specifically in the Bauhaus of the Seas, using digital storytelling to connect coastal societies with their shared history with the sea.
